The Good
- Variety of Payment Methods: Virginbet offers an array of options including debit cards, e-wallets like PayPal and Skrill, and bank transfers. This diversity ensures that most players can find a preferred method.
- Fast Withdrawals: Most e-wallet transactions are processed within 24 hours, ensuring that players can access their winnings promptly.
- Secure Transactions: All payment methods are secured with advanced encryption technologies, aligning with UKGC regulations to provide a safe gaming environment.
- VIP Treatment: High-rollers have access to tailored limits and priority processing, enhancing their overall experience.
The Bad
- Withdrawal Limits: While e-wallets have relatively high limits, traditional methods like bank transfers may cap withdrawals at £5,000 per transaction, which can be restrictive for VIP players.
- Processing Fees: Certain payment methods incur fees, which are not always clearly disclosed at the time of deposit or withdrawal, potentially leading to unexpected costs.
- Limited Availability of Certain Options: Some players may find that preferred methods such as cryptocurrency are not supported, limiting flexibility.
The Ugly
- Withdrawal Times for Bank Transfers: While e-wallets are swift, bank transfers can take up to 3-5 business days, which may frustrate players accustomed to immediate access to funds.
- Inconsistent Customer Support: High-rollers may encounter delays in customer support responsiveness, particularly when dealing with complex financial queries.
- Wagering Requirements: Some promotions linked to payment methods have wagering requirements of up to 35x, which can be daunting for players intending to cash out quickly.
| Payment Method | Deposit Time | Withdrawal Time | Withdrawal Limit | Fees |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Debit Cards | Instant | 3-5 business days | £5,000 per transaction | None |
| PayPal | Instant | Within 24 hours | Up to £10,000 | None |
| Skrill | Instant | Within 24 hours | Up to £10,000 | None |
| Bank Transfer | 1-3 business days | 3-5 business days | £5,000 per transaction | Varies |
